Lanthanum Oxide (La2O3), with its exceptional purity of 99.999.0%, represents a critical rare earth compound for a wide array of sophisticated laboratory applications. This ultra-high purity grade ensures reliable and reproducible results in sensitive experiments and demanding research environments. Known for its remarkable chemical stability and high melting point, Lanthanum Oxide is an indispensable material in the development of advanced ceramics, specialized glasses, and high-performance electronic components. Its unique optical properties make it valuable in the creation of optical fibers, lenses, and infrared-absorbing materials. Furthermore, its role as a promoter or support in various catalytic processes, particularly in pollution control and petrochemical conversions, underscores its versatility. How should Lanthanum Oxide be stored to maintain its integrity? Lanthanum Oxide should be stored in a tightly sealed container in a cool, dry, and well-ventilated area, away from moisture and incompatible materials, to prevent degradation and maintain its purity. 4. What precautions should be taken when handling Lanthanum Oxide powder? When handling Lanthanum Oxide powder, it is recommended to wear appropriate personal protective equipment, including gloves, safety glasses, and a dust mask, to prevent inhalation and skin contact. Work in a well-ventilated area.
